Christuskirche Wernigerode: A Unique Architectural Gem

Christuskirche Wernigerode stands as a testament to Protestant heritage in Wernigerode, Germany. Opened in 1892, it was established by founder Johannes Müller and serves as a cultural landmark in the region.

The church features neo-Gothic architecture with intricate stained glass windows and a notable tower that reaches 60 meters high. Its historical significance is reflected in its role in the local community, hosting numerous cultural and religious events throughout the year.
